Product Photographer & Website Administrator
Sutton Coldfield £26,000-£28,000 Full-time, Office Based

Our client - a leading UK bullion dealer - is looking for a skilled Product Photographer & Website Listing Administrator to join their growing ecommerce and marketing team.

This is a fantastic opportunity for someone creative, detail driven, and confident working in a fast paced environment. You'll produce high quality product imagery in the in-house studio while also supporting accurate product uploads across CMS systems (full training provided).

The Role Product Photography
  • Capture and retouch high quality imagery using Sony full frame cameras and continuous lighting.
  • Create marketing visuals for web, social and digital campaigns.
  • Optimise, format and organise images to brand standards.
  • Maintain a structured digital image library.
  • Manage workloads and deadlines using Asana.
Website Listing Administration (Training Provided)
  • Create accurate product listings for new and pre owned coins and bars.
  • Input precise product data (weight, fineness, tax class, descriptions, manufacturer).
  • Generate new SKUs and ensure consistency across CMS systems.
  • Verify stock and update website content with exceptional attention to detail.
  • Track tasks and priorities using Asana.
About You
  • 1-2 years' photography and retouching experience.
  • Confident with Sony cameras, continuous lighting and Adobe Photoshop.
  • Strong organisation, accuracy and written communication skills.
  • Able to work independently in a fast paced environment.
  • Basic graphic design experience (e.g. Canva) is beneficial.
